Heads up, release folks: before you cut a release of Brindlewasp (our alert deduplicator), make sure the fingerprint schema version matches what the Oakmere collectors emit. A mismatch means alerts stop collapsing and on-call gets paged for every replica — not fun. Run the pre-release compat check in staging, wait for two green cycles, then tag. If the dedupe ratio dashboard dips below 0.8 after rollout, roll back immediately and ping the Sentry-Owl rotation. The full release checklist lives on the internal page linked below.

operations page: https://jenkins.zemvarcloud.local/job/merge_requests/repo/build/73930b4b30f0a8ed

Ticket: Staging env misconfigured for Siftgate bloom filter

The bloom layer in front of the Pellet KV store is rejecting all lookups in staging because the env file was copied from the dev template without credentials. False-positive tuning values are fine; only the auth line is missing. To unblock the weekly demo, the Pellet admission secret must be set on the following line.

env line for yaguf-fajop: LEDGER_TOKEN13=fb08984397349

Subject: Component library versioning — quick primer

Hi, welcome to the rotation. The Brindlewood shared component library (kitewing-ui) uses strict semver, but minor bumps occasionally land breaking CSS changes, so pin exact versions in consumer apps. Releases cut every Tuesday; hotfixes get a patch tag within the hour. If a consumer breaks after a bump, roll back first, debug second. Release notes, deprecation schedule, and the pinning policy are all kept on one internal page, which you can find here.

runbook for tafof-yawif: https://confluence.tolvaqsys.internal/display/display/browse/pages/7be3

- [ ] **Step 7: Breaker override escrow.** After sealing the signing keys for the Tallgrove upstream API circuit breaker, confirm the support team can force the breaker open during a full outage. The override bundle lives in the sealed escrow drawer and is useless without its unlock phrase. Two ceremony witnesses must initial this step before proceeding. The escrow bundle is decrypted with the recovery passphrase that follows.

vault phrase of kahip-kahop = holath-quenmir